Frequently Asked Questions about Downtown East

What type of rentals are currently available in Downtown East?

There are currently 171 Apartments for Rent in Downtown East, NV with pricing that ranges from $676 to $1,835. There are also 17 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Downtown East ranging from $850 to $2,800.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Downtown East?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Downtown East ranges from $850 to $2,800 with an average monthly rent of $1,334.
